對於linux新手來說,好不容易裝了個軟體,卻發現不知道裝在哪裡了,找不到,甚至卸載都很費勁,總結了一下路徑問題匯總:在
Linux中查看某個軟體的安裝路徑(位址)有時顯得非常重要。例如某個檔案的快速啟動項被刪除,或是你要建立快速啟動項,或是想刪除、 新增安裝檔等等,很多地方都要用到查案文件安裝路徑的指令。
這裡要跟大家介紹Linux查看檔案安裝路徑(位址)指令。
一、檢視檔案安裝路徑:
由於軟體安裝的地方不只一個地方,所有先說檢視檔案安裝的所有路徑(位址)。這裡以hbase
為例。
比如說我安裝了Oracle,但我不知道檔案都安裝在哪些地方、放在哪些資料夾裡,可以用下面的指令查看所有的檔案路徑。
linux學習影片分享:linux影片教學
在終端機輸入:
whereis hbase
回車,如果你安裝好了hbase,就會顯示文件安裝的位址,例如我的顯示(安裝地址可能會不同)。
hbase: /usr/bin/hbase /etc/hbase
如果你沒有安裝hbase或hbase安裝沒成功,就不會顯示檔案路徑出來。只提示:
hbase:
二、查詢運行文件所在路徑:
#如果你只要查詢文件的運行文件所在地址,直接用下面的命令就可以了(還是以Oracle為例):
which oracle
結果會顯示:
/usr/bin/oracle
三、檢視軟體的安裝路徑
以mysql為例:
1、可以直接輸入指令:
service mysql status
如果裝了的話,預設是開啟的。如果沒裝,會有提示。
沒裝的話,輸入指令:
apt-get install mysql-server
就行了。 (ubuntu系統這樣就可以了。)
2、
mysql --version
3、透過rpm
查看
四、查看軟體是否安裝
首先我們需要查看軟體是否已經安裝,或是說要查看安裝的軟體套件名稱。如查找是否安裝mysql
rpm -qa |grep mysql
4、rpm -ql 列出軟體包安裝的檔案
rpm -ql xxx(安装包名称)
5、rpm -qal |grep mysql 查看mysql所有安裝包的檔案儲存位置
rpm -qal |grep mysql
6、透過yum search 尋找對應可以安裝的軟體包
yum search mysql
7、除了根據軟體包來找檔案位置之外,最常用的就是透過find查找某個關鍵字例如mysql所有包含mysql服務的檔案路徑
find / -name mysql
8、Which指令是透過 PATH環境變數來尋找可執行檔路徑,用來尋找指向這個指令所在的資料夾
which mysql
9、Whereis指令和find類似,不過不同的是whereis是透過本地架構好的資料庫索引查找會比較快。如果沒有更新到資料庫裡面的檔案或指令則無法查找到資訊
whereis mysql
相關文章教學推薦:linux教學
#以上是linux新手如何知道程式安裝在哪裡的詳細內容。更多資訊請關注PHP中文網其他相關文章!